Reporting to the Regional Director, the Project Manager provides the necessary leadership to bid, plan, organize, direct, coordinate, and control assigned projects. Along with your project team, you will be given control of your project to deliver it on time while keeping your client engaged and informed throughout.

**Position Responsibilities**:
- Here’s what your day-to-day looks like:_
- Guide the project forward with the assistance of your project team
- Ensure site safety meets Lindsay Construction policy and legislated requirements
- Maintain efficient operation and coordination of all project facets from start to finish, including cost estimate, gross profit, schedule, and quality
- Preserve client satisfaction through regular communication and timely responses to inquiries
- Certify that the collection of progress billings, final payment, and holdbacks are handled in a timely manner
- Provide leadership to the project team on all aspects of the project
- Work cooperatively with other project teams
**Job Requirements**
- 5 years or more of experience running all aspects of mid to high-rise residential building projects
- Post-secondary education in Engineering, or a construction-related field
- Familiar with estimating, scheduling, subcontract coordination, and material procurement
- Excellent project management skills, including the ability to plan and prioritize tasks effectively
- Great organizational skills and ability to work on several projects at once if needed
- Ability to communicate in an effective way to all stakeholders
- Exceptional teamwork and interpersonal skills
